Pros & Cons
Pros & Cons
pros
- Visually Engaging: Each topic is paired with a stunning photograph and clear illustrations that make complex weather phenomena easier to understand.
- Comprehensive Coverage: Covers a wide range of topics-from cloud formations to extreme weather safety-making it a handy reference for weather enthusiasts and novices alike.
- Accessible language: Uses straightforward explanations, making it suitable for all ages and knowledge levels.
- Compact & Portable: With its small size and light weight, it’s easy to carry along on outdoor adventures or keep on your bookshelf.
- Educational and Fun: Includes interesting facts and tips that enhance observational skills and deepen understanding of North American weather patterns.
Cons
- Limited Depth: As a pocket guide,it provides a broad overview but lacks the detailed analysis found in specialized meteorological texts.
- Region-Specific: Focuses on North American weather, which might limit its usefulness for those interested in global phenomena.
- Basic Illustrations: Visuals are simple and may not satisfy those looking for more technical or comprehensive graphics.
- Not a Real-Time Reference: Doesn’t include current weather data or forecasts, so it’s more of a learning tool than a live weather source.
